- Weisz began her acting career in the early 1990s, appearing in Inspector Morse, Scarlet and Black and Advocates II
- She made her film debut in Death Machine (1994)
- Her first Hollywood appearance was in Chain Reaction (1996), opposite Keanu Reeves and Morgan Freeman
- She has worked in theatre
- Her stage breakthrough was the 1994 revival of Noël Coward's play Design for Living, which earned her the London Critics' Circle Award for the most promising newcomer
- Weisz's performances also include the 1999 Donmar Warehouse production of Tennessee Williams' Suddenly, Last Summer, and their 2009 revival of A Streetcar Named Desire
- Her portrayal of Blanche DuBois in the latter play earned her the Olivier Award for Best Actress
- Weisz appeared in the film, The Mummy in 1999, and The Mummy Returns in 2001
- Other films that followed are, Enemy at the Gates (2001), About a Boy (2002), Constantine (2005) and Darren Aronofsky's The Fountain
- For her supporting role in the drama thriller The Constant Gardener (2005), opposite Ralph Fiennes, she received an Academy Award, a Golden Globe and a Screen Actors' Guild award
